lacp port-priority

To configure the LACP port priority, use the command lacp port-priority in Interface Configuration Mode. The no form of the command resets the LACP port priority to its default value.

lacp port-priority

lacp port-priority { <priority (0-65535)> }

no lacp port-priority

Parameters

Parameter Type Description
<priority (0-65535)> Integer Enter a value to configure the LACP port priority. This value ranges from 0 to 65535. This port priority is used in combination with LACP port identifier during the identification of best ports in a port channel. The priority determines if the link is an active link or a standby link, when the number of ports in the aggregation exceeds the maximum number supported by the hardware. The links with lower priority become active links. The default is 128.

Mode

Interface Configuration Mode

Prerequisites

This command executes successfully, only if
  • the LA functionality is started and enabled in the switch.
  • This configuration takes effect only on the interface that is configured for LACP
  • The LACP port priority will not be reset to its default value if the port is removed from one port channel and added to another port channel.

Examples

iS5Comm(config)# int gi 0/9

iS5Comm(config- if)# lacp port-priority 1
